#317189 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#317189 is composed of 19.2% red, 44.3%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 17.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 196.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#317189 color hex could be obtained by blending #62e2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#317189 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#317189 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#317189 has RGB values of R:49, G:113,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3240329.

Shades and Tints of #317189
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#317189
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5d5e is the less saturated color, while #0685b4 is the most saturated one.
